Union of Producers and Employers of the Biogas and Biomethane Industry (UPEBBI) was established in 2012. We are an employers’ association operating under the Employers’ Organizations Act, and we enjoy all the benefits associated with this special status. We bring together enterprises primarily engaged in operating, as well as designing, building, and servicing biogas plants and biomethanation plants, as well as entities from the business environment (engaged, for example, in energy trading, EU subsidies, or installation insurance).

Our goal is to work together for the sake of the biogas and biomethane industry in the country, as well as in Europe and worldwide (as a participant of the European Biogas Association, World Biogas Association, and Biomethane Industrial Partnership). Within the framework of the EU Erasmus+ programme, we undertake international cooperation, e.g., with analogous organizations from the Czech Republic and Latvia in the project “Training of Personnel for the European Biogas Sector.”
The overriding aim of UPEBBI is to provide members with comprehensive assistance and legal protection as well as to shape a unified stance on all matters related to their business activities. We are the largest industry organization animating the Biogas and Biomethane Agreement, which consists of six entities representing the vast majority of the sector. We work regularly with lawyers, experts, scientists, officials, and industry practitioners in order to optimize the effects of our activities.
We collaborate with scientific and research institutions (universities, academies, and state research institutes) to develop innovative technological solutions that contribute to a more dynamic development of the industry in Poland and around the world. Together with the University of Life Sciences in Lublin, the Institute of Biotechnology of the Agri-Food Industry, and Agricultural Training Centres, we create Industry Skill Centres in the field of bioenergy (in the Lublin region and in Pomerania) designed for the education of students, teachers, and adults.
We conduct educational and promotional activities in order to raise the public’s knowledge about the possibilities of producing and using biogas as a renewable source of energy and biomethane as a gaseous fuel, for instance by conducting workshops for hundreds of people nationwide (potential investors, employees of local government units, and students of agricultural schools) commissioned by the National Agricultural Support Centre or by training employees of the Provincial Fund for Environmental Protection and Water Management in Białystok.
We have repeatedly and successfully intervened at the stage of drafting laws and regulations concerning the biogas sector. We maintain working contacts with the Ministry of Climate and Environment (divisions of renewable energy sources and waste management) and the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development (division of energy transformation in rural areas), as well as with the National Fund for Environmental Protection and Water Management and the Institute of Environmental Protection. We regularly take part in legislative and consultative works at the level of the Sejm and the Senate, participating in committee and team meetings and engaging in discussions with particularly interested MPs and senators.
We participate in social consultations and provide information about biogas and biomethane to all those interested in this topic. We promote biogas technology in conventional and social media as well as at all events, conferences, and trade fairs related to renewable energy sources (e.g., at the Economic Forum in Karpacz, the European Economic Congress in Katowice, the Distributed Energy Congress in Kraków, the Poznań Economic Congress in Poznań, the Eco Forum in Supraśl and Tykocin, EuroPower and OZEPower in Warsaw, or during the Central Agricultural Fair at Warsaw Ptak Expo).
We organize Green Gas Poland [https://greengaspoland.pl/] as an annual international conference of the biogas and biomethane industry, which over five editions has attracted hundreds of participants: representatives of private companies and the State Treasury, state offices and governmental agencies, energy and biogas media, as well as scientists, investors, farmers, and local government officials.
